The GeForce MX350 is at least 2x slower gaming GPU than the Radeon RX 6650 XT. We cannot compare value as at least one GPU is out of stock.
Advantages of the GeForce MX350
- Consumes up to 89% less energy – 20 vs 176 Watts
Advantages of the Radeon RX 6650 XT
- At least 2x faster GPU for gaming
- Up to 300% more VRAM memory – 8 vs 2 GB

Specifications
Comparison of all specifications
GeForce MX350 | SpecificationsComparison of all specifications | Radeon RX 6650 XT |
---|---|---|
General | ||
Feb 10th, 2020 | Release Date | May 10th, 2022 |
Not Available | MSRP | $399.00 |
GeForce MX | Generation | Navi II |
Laptop | Segment | Desktop |
20 W | Power Consumption | 176 W |
Memory | ||
2 GB | Memory Size | 8 GB |
GDDR5 | Memory Type | GDDR6 |
64-bit | Memory Bus | 128-bit |
56.06 GB/s | Bandwidth | 280.3 GB/s |
Theoretical Performance | ||
14.99 GPixel/s | Pixel Fillrate | 168.6 GPixel/s |
29.98 GTexel/s | Texture Fillrate | 337.3 GTexel/s |
1.199 TFLOPS | FP32 | 10.79 TFLOPS |
